H.G. Wells is often regarded as one of the patron saints of science fiction. His works like 'The War of the Worlds' and 'The Time Machine' were highly influential. These novels introduced many concepts that became staples in the science fiction genre, such as time travel and alien invasions.

Troll fiction is basically stories that are written to be a bit of a prank on the reader. It can be really out - there, like having characters do the most ridiculous things for no good reason other than to make you laugh or scratch your head. Some troll fictions might start out seeming like a normal story but then go completely off the rails.
